How to Claim a No Deposit Bonus Without Getting Burned
I have developed a personal checklist. You should use it too.
- Find the offer: Search for “no deposit bonus 2026 uk claim today” on comparison sites. But ignore the ones that look spammy.
- Read the T&Cs before you click: Look for the wagering requirement. Anything above 40x is tough. 50x is nearly impossible.
- Check the max cashout: Some casinos cap your winnings at £20 or £50. If you win £200, you only get £50.
- Check the game restrictions: Many bonuses only work on specific slots. And those slots often have lower RTPs.
- Verify the expiry: You might have 7 days to use the bonus. Or 24 hours. Yes, I have seen 24-hour expiry on a “free sign up bonus no deposit 2026 uk claim today”.
- Complete KYC early: Upload your ID and proof of address immediately. If you win and then try to verify, the casino might delay your withdrawal for days.

The Hidden Trap: Wagering Requirements on “Free Sign Up Bonus No Deposit 2026 UK Claim Today” Offers
Let me give you a real example. I found a “free sign up bonus no deposit 2026 uk claim today” from a well-known brand. The offer was £10 free. The wagering was 45x. That means I had to bet £450 before I could withdraw anything. The bonus only worked on a slot with an RTP of 94%. So my expected loss on that wagering was around £27. I was starting with only £10. The math says I would almost certainly lose the bonus before meeting the playthrough.
Do not fall for the headline. Look at the numbers. If the wagering is above 40x and the max cashout is below £50, the offer is borderline useless. I only claim bonuses where the wagering is 35x or lower and the max cashout is at least £100.
